A leading hospice care provider in the United Kingdom is seeking an experienced Finance Assistant to support the accounts payable function. You will handle processing supplier invoices, ensuring timely payments, and contributing to robust financial operations.

Ideal candidates will have AAT qualifications, advanced Excel skills, and strong communication abilities.

The role offers a competitive salary, generous annual leave, and opportunities for career development in a supportive environment.

How to prepare for a job interview at Keech Hospice Care

Know Your Numbers

Brush up on your financial knowledge, especially around accounts payable processes. Be ready to discuss how you’ve handled supplier invoices and ensured timely payments in your previous roles.

Excel Skills on Display

Since advanced Excel skills are a must, prepare to showcase your proficiency. You might be asked to solve a problem or demonstrate how you would use Excel for financial reporting, so practice common functions and formulas.

Communicate Clearly

Strong communication abilities are key in this role. Think of examples where you’ve effectively communicated with suppliers or team members to resolve issues. Practise articulating these experiences clearly and confidently.

Show Your AAT Knowledge

If you have AAT qualifications, be prepared to discuss how they’ve equipped you for the role. Highlight specific areas of your training that relate to accounts payable and how you can apply that knowledge in a practical setting.
